A federal judge Monday dismissed a lawsuit brought by Elon Musk‘s X against the Center for Countering Digital Hate, ruling it was “evident” the litigation was intended “to punish CCDH for CCDH publications that criticized X Corp.” X, the Musk-owned social network formerly known as , in July 2023 sued the Center for Countering Digital Hate, an independent nonprofit research group, over the organization’s findings that since the multibillionaire had acquired the company in October 2022, hate, racism and disinformation on the social platform had substantially increased.
